I'm a professional coach and I have seen beginner (27+ min 1500) to intermediate swimmers (~22-26 min 1500) improve by 10% or more and advanced swimmers (under 22 for 1500) improve by 1-2%.

Total Immersion is not the end-all-be-all of swim technique, but it is hard to argue with physics. One of my clients got a side view video ot Ian horpe at the lasy Olympics and it was amazing how closely he followed the TI principles.
